An Attalla man has been charged with child abuse in Etowah County. Certanishta Pierce, 51, is charged with one count of child abuse for allegedly abusing a 16-year-old male, investigator Tracey Bishop said. The sheriff's office says Pierce allegedly abused the victim since August 2011. The abuse reportedly happened at a location on Owls Hollow Road. Pierce was arrested on Aug. 1 during a court proceeding. He is being held in the Etowah County Detention Center on a $10,000 bond.
